For EPF and ESI, you can buy any books that contain rules, regulations, and schemes under the Acts. There are no Acts on salary and benefits exclusively for SSI. Simply because a unit is an SSI, there are no exemptions from any labor laws.

Dear Pradeep,

I would like to recommend the following books written by Sh. HL Kumar, who is an Advocate and Editor of Labour Law Reporter:

(a) Practical Guide to Employees' Provident Funds Act, Rules, and Schemes
(b) Practical Guide to Employees State Insurance Act, Rules, and Regulations

I have been using these two books for reference, and I find them very handy, useful, and exhaustive. The books contain case laws referencer, different schemes at a glance, obligations of an employer under these Acts, day-to-day problems, and their clarifications, etc.
